Transaction 702d958700040f49c577867d1f7ffc6c2ad3e6d46e40907e32b72349f308b90f
1 Input
2 Outputs
- 702d958700040f49c577867d1f7ffc6c2ad3e6d46e40907e32b72349f308b90f:0
- 702d958700040f49c577867d1f7ffc6c2ad3e6d46e40907e32b72349f308b90f:1
value 43212689
address 171Y1FPepEMWUENhdfw99mYpN6ehHNYuF7
value 631193
address 14fsJS344YDBkYtB6krH5s91y4kNYoZjMC